Skip to Content
חלק ד׳ — תכונות מתקדמותSkills — תבניות פרומפט לשימוש חוזר

Skills — תבניות פרומפט לשימוש חוזר

💡

Skills הם תבניות פרומפט שנטענות רק כאשר צריך אותן — lazy loading. הם חוסכים tokens כי הם לא טעונים בזיכרון כל הזמן, אלא רק כשמשתמשים בהם.

מה זה Skill?

Skill הוא בעצם קיצור דרך לפרומפט או פיסת ידע קטנה — קובץ Markdown פשוט שClaude טוען כשקוראים לו. במקום לכתוב את אותו הפרומפט שוב ושוב, מגדירים Skill פעם אחת ומשתמשים בו בפקודה פשוטה.

איך Skill נראה מבפנים?

הנה דוגמה מקוצרת של Skill אמיתי — requesting-code-review (24.2K התקנות):

# Code Review Agent
 
You are reviewing code changes for production readiness.
 
**Your task:**
1. Review the implementation
2. Compare against requirements
3. Check code quality, architecture, testing
4. Categorize issues by severity
 
## Review Checklist
 
**Code Quality:**
- Clean separation of concerns?
- Proper error handling?
- Edge cases handled?
 
**Testing:**
- Tests actually test logic (not mocks)?
- All tests passing?
 
**Production Readiness:**
- Backward compatibility?
- Documentation complete?

זה הכל — קובץ Markdown עם הוראות. כש-Claude טוען את ה-Skill, הוא מקבל את הפרומפט הזה ישירות ל-Context ופועל לפיו. אין קוד, אין API — רק טקסט שמכוון את ה-AI.

Lazy Loading — חיסכון ב-tokens

ללא Skillsעם Skills
פרומפטיםבזיכרון תמיד → בזבוז tokensנטענים רק כשקוראים להם → חיסכון משמעותי
דיאגרמת lazy loading של Skills — Skills נטענות מה-disk לזיכרון רק כאשר מפעילים אותן

ארכיטקטורת Skills: lazy loading חוסך tokens

גילוי Skills מותקנות

skills — גילוי Skills מותקנות
/skills
Installed skills:
obra/superpowers@requesting-code-review (24.2K installs)
obra/superpowers@receiving-code-review (19K installs)
wshobson/agents@nextjs-app-router-patterns (8.6K installs)
sergiodxa/agent-skills@frontend-react-best-practices (405 installs)
jwilger/agent-skills@tdd (68 installs)

הפקודה מציגה את כל ה-Skills המותקנות במכונה שלכם.

הקטלוג הקהילתי — skills.sh

skills.sh  הוא הקטלוג הקהילתי ל-Skills. תוכלו:

  • לגלות Skills שאחרים כתבו
  • להוריד Skills שימושיות
  • לפרסם Skills שכתבתם

התקנת Skill

skills — התקנה
npx skills add obra/superpowers@requesting-code-review

לדוגמה:

skills — התקנת Skills קהילתיות
npx skills add obra/superpowers@requesting-code-review
✓ Installed obra/superpowers@requesting-code-review
npx skills add wshobson/agents@nextjs-app-router-patterns
✓ Installed wshobson/agents@nextjs-app-router-patterns
npx skills add jwilger/agent-skills@tdd
✓ Installed jwilger/agent-skills@tdd

שימוש ב-Skill

לאחר ההתקנה, פשוט קוראים ל-Skill בשם:

skills — שימוש
/requesting-code-review
# מפעיל את ה-code review skill
/tdd
# מפעיל את ה-TDD skill

יתרונות Skills

יתרוןתיאור
חיסכון ב-tokensלא נטענים כשלא צריך אותם
עקביותאותו פרומפט בכל ריצה
שיתוף צוותכל חבר צוות משתמש באותן הגדרות
גרסאותניהול גרסאות עם git
📖

לתיעוד הרשמי המלא: Skills — Claude Code Docs